NOROI: The Japanese Horror That Feels Disturbingly Real

<p>Noroi doesn’t scare you with loud moments or fast pacing.<br>It unsettles you by feeling real — like something uncovered rather than created.</p><p>In this episode, we break down the Japanese horror film Noroi, exploring its documentary-style storytelling, fragmented clues, and the slow-building sense that something ancient is quietly resurfacing. From folklore-inspired symbolism to the way information is revealed piece by piece, this is a deep dive into why Noroi leaves such a lasting impression long after it ends.</p><p></p>

Train to Busan Changed Zombie Horror Forever

<p>What if the most terrifying part of a zombie story isn’t the creatures… but the people trapped together when everything falls apart?</p><p>In this episode, we’re exploring how Train to Busan didn’t just revive zombie cinema—it evolved it, reshaping how modern horror tells stories about fear, survival, class, family, and human behavior under pressure.</p><p>From its emotional realism to its relentless pacing, this film sparked a new global wave of zombie storytelling—and its influence can still be felt today in movies, series, and games around the world.</p><p>This is the evolution of zombie horror… from mindless outbreaks to mirrors of society itself.</p><p><br /></p>

The Eye (2002): When Sight Becomes a Curse

<p>What if gaining sight meant losing your sense of safety?</p><p><br /></p><p>In this episode, we explore The Eye (2002), the haunting psychological horror film by the Pang Brothers that redefined atmospheric fear in Asian cinema. Unlike traditional horror, The Eye doesn’t rely on constant shocks—it builds dread through implication, isolation, and the terrifying idea that some things are hidden for a reason.</p><p><br /></p><p>Perfect for late-night listening, this episode dives into why The Eye remains one of the most unforgettable horror films of the early 2000s, and how it influenced a generation of psychological and supernatural storytelling.</p><p></p>
